### Runbook: BounceBroom — Account Recovery

If the BounceBroom email bounce processor loses access to its service account, do not create a new one. First, pause the intake queue so bounces buffer safely. Then open the recovery console and select the BounceBroom principal. Verification requires approval from the on-call lead. Once approved, the console prompts for the stored recovery credentials; enter the passphrase that appears directly below this paragraph.

recovery phrase for fahof-kahap: holion-gormir-jorix-istix-briwyn-sorael

Account Recovery — Runbook 4.2 (Slimline Images)

After the Pellago registry migration, our recovery tooling ships in a slimmed container image: the base was swapped to minimal-alpine and debug shells were stripped. Support staff restoring a locked Vantrel account must pull the :recovery tag, not :latest, since the slim image excludes the legacy reset module. Once the container starts, authenticate the session using the passphrase below.

unlock words, yawig-kagef: gordor-holvan-ulaael-pramir-ulaiel-tamdor

Step 4 — Publish the solver image

After the Timegrid scheduler passes the constraint regression suite, tag the build and push it to the Classroomer registry. New team members: do not skip the conflict-matrix check; an unsolvable timetable will pass unit tests but fail in staging. The registry only accepts pushes authenticated with the deploy key below.

deploy key for yagap-kawig: bky4_Q8dK

## Flaky Integration Tests

Welcome aboard! You'll hear a lot about the Pennywhistle payments suite and its, uh, moody integration tests. Most flakes come from the ledger sandbox resetting mid-run — retry once before panicking. If a test fails twice in a row, it's probably real; hold the release train. We track known flakes on the Quarantine board, so check there before filing anything new. For quarantine additions or release-blocking questions, reach the test stewards here.

alerts address for kajog-tadup: druox@plorvanet.internal